图书管理系统

在计算机软件技术中,人机界面已经发展成为一个重要的分支。

1.以通信功能作为界面设计的核心

2.界面必须始终一致

3.界面必须使用户随时掌握任务的进展情况

4.界面必须能够提供帮助

5.界面友好、使用方便

6.输入画面尽可能接近实际

7.具有较强的容错功能

2.及时全面地提供不同要求的、不同细度的信息,以期分析解释现象最快,及时产生正确的控制。

面向对象的程序设计思想(Object-orientedProgramming,简称OOP)的主要目的是要创建可以重用的代码,具备更好的模拟现实世界环境的能力,它通过给程序中加入扩展语句,把函数“封装”进Windows编程所必须的“对象”中,面向对象的编程语言使得复杂的工作条理清晰、编写容易,使人们从结构化的编程思想走到了面向对象的编程思想上。

1.对象

2.类

3.继承

4.消息

PowerBuilder的窗口和控件对象

窗口由属性、事件以及放置在窗口里面的的控件组成。

窗口的属性定义了窗口的显示和行为。

PowerBuilder提供了6种类型的窗口,他们是:主窗口、弹出式窗口、子窗口、响应式窗口、多文档界面框架窗口,以及带宏帮助的多文档界面框架窗口。

下拉式菜单出现在菜单栏的某个菜单项下面,他能够通过鼠标单击访问,也可以通过按Alt键的同时按下带有下划线的字符来访问。

级联菜单是可以出现在以上两种类型菜单上的一种菜单,有时称为二级菜单。通常在父菜单项上有一个右箭头表示它,可以通过点击这个右箭头访问它。

PowerBuilder的技术核心数据窗口对象

使用数据窗口对象的方法如下:

●排序数据

●数据的过滤

●数据的分组

●数据窗口中数据的存储

●指定更新属性

(1)设置事务对象的属性值

(2)与数据库建立连接

(3)执行所需的数据库操作

(4)断开与数据库的连接

需求分析可分为问题分析、需求描述及需求评审三个阶段

本图书馆管理系统适应于中小规模公共图书馆、中小学及各院校图书馆

本系统的服务对象为图书馆流通部门的工作人员,用户界面友好,不需计算机专业的专门训练即可使用本系统。

图书管理处理的信息量比较大。因此对于本系统的设计,需要采取以下一些原则:

★程序代码标准化,软件统一化,确保软件的可维护性和实用性

开发的软硬件要求

软件要求:MicrosoftWindows98操作系统及Powerbuilder8.0数据库系统。

综合考虑系统的逻辑模型和设计系统目标的要求绘制的系统功能结构

在系统主窗口中选择“借阅图书”,进入“借阅图书”。

使用时单击“借阅”按钮或直接按回车键,光标定位于“借阅人编码或姓名”项。

如果单击“放弃”按钮,则取消本次借阅操作。

单击“还书”选项或直接按回车键,光标定位于“借阅人编码或姓名”项。

在系统主窗口中,选择“打印催还单”,进入“打印催还单”窗口。该窗口中列出了所有当归还图书人员的列表。该窗口共设3个按钮,分别是“全部打印”、“选择打印”和“退出”。

如果选择“全部打印”按钮,将打印出应归还图书的人员名单;也可以首先使用手型指针选择要打印清单的单位,然后单击“选择打印”按钮打印。

1.个人借阅查询

在系统主窗口中,选择“信息查询”菜单中的“个人借阅查询”选项,进入“个人借阅查询”窗口。

个人借阅查询窗口

输入借阅人编码,按回车键或单击“确认”按钮,窗口将显示该人员的全部借阅信息。如果系统中无该借阅人或该借阅人未借阅过任何图书,窗口将不显示任何信息。

2.催还书目浏览

如果选择“催还书目查询”选项,则进入“催还书目查询”窗口,该窗口中显示所有已到期但尚未归还的书目信息。

催还书目查询窗口

3.图书分布情况查询

如果选择“图书分布查询”选项,则进入“图书分布查询”窗口,该窗口在初始状态下显示所有书目的摘要信息。

图书分布查询窗口

如果要查看某本书的具体信息,可双击该书摘要信息处。

4.按关键字查询

如果选择“按关键字查询”选项,则进入“关键字查询”窗口。

通过输入关键字,用户可以模糊查询,也可以精确查询。如果查询结果只有一本书,系统将直接显示该书的具体信息。实现精确查询时,系统将直接显示该书的具体信息。如果书库中无该书,则窗口中不显示任何信息。

书库维护包括新书入库、查询显示、全部显示及删除等模块。

书库维护窗口

对书库进行任何修改后,系统执行退出时,将查看数据库是否已被修改,然后提示用户是否保存修改并按用户要求进行相应操作。

THE END
1.图书管理系统的实体信息及实体之间的联系文章浏览阅读1.2k次。_实践需求:根据图书管理系统的实体信息及实体之间的联系,设计出图书管理系统的e-rhttps://blog.csdn.net/m0_63468366/article/details/129307648
2.图书馆管理系统中实体图书和实体借阅人之间的联系是刷刷题APP(shuashuati.com)是专业的大学生刷题搜题拍题答疑工具,刷刷题提供图书馆管理系统中实体图书和实体借阅人之间的联系是A.1:1B.N:1C.1:ND.M:N的答案解析,刷刷题为用户提供专业的考试题库练习。一分钟将考试题Word文档/Excel文档/PDF文档转化为在线题库,制作自己的https://www.shuashuati.com/ti/460d2e7d12b94afcab3c8204930f99a7.html
3.图书馆管理系统因此本人结合开入式图书馆的要求,对MS SQL Server2000数据库管理系统、SQL语言原理、Delphi应用程序设计,Delphi数据库技术进行了较深入的学习和应用,主要完成对图书管理系统的需求分析、功能模块划分、数据库模式分析,并由此设计了数据库结构和应用程序。系统运行结果证明,本文所设计的图书管理系统可以满足借阅者、图书馆https://www.fwsir.com/ligong/html/ligong_20070130182525_25748.html
4.图书管理系统数据模型ER图20240203.pptx添加标题E-R图的设计原则关系(Relationship):表示实体之间的联系或关联,具有关系类型和约束条件实体(Entity):表示现实世界中的事物或对象,具有属性和行为属性(Attribute):表示实体的特征或特性,具有数据类型和约束条件设计原则:简洁、清晰、易于理解、易于维护、易于扩展图书管理系统实体分析PART04图书馆实体罚款:读者逾期https://m.renrendoc.com/paper/309783453.html
5.第一个Java项目———Java实现简单图书管理系统(GUI)暑假写了个图书管理系统,编译器用的是eclipse,加入了WindowBuilder插件做界面(做的特丑),数据库用的是MySQL。 实现了图书的查询,借阅,归还,删除,增加。用户的删除,查询。分为管理员和用户。 源码地址(GitHub):GitHub – best-bo-cai/books_management: 我的第一个java小项目:图书管理系统编译器用的是eclipse,加入https://cloud.tencent.com/developer/article/2105825
6.mysql图书管理er图图书管理数据库系统er图mysql图书管理er图 图书管理数据库系统er图 数据库ER图 ER图分为实体、属性、关系三个核心部分。实体是长方形体现,而属性则是椭圆形,关系为菱形。 ER图的实体(entity)即数据模型中的数据对象,例如人、学生、音乐都可以作为一个数据对象,用长方体来表示,每个实体都有自己的实体成员(entity member)或者说实体对象(https://blog.51cto.com/u_16099185/8995255
7.图书馆管理系统er图图书馆管理系统er图 1、要了解ER图的核心要素:实体,属性,关系,实体就是一个个对象,比如猫,属性就是实体所有的某个属性,比如猫的性别,关系就是实体和实体之间或者实体内部之间的关系。 2、要了解ER图中怎么表示1中描述的三个核心要素:在ER图中矩形代表实体,椭圆代表属性,菱形代表关系,各个形状之间用线段连接。 https://www.zboao.com/cgal/9078.html
8.mybatis实现图书管理系统java这篇文章主要为大家详细介绍了mybatis实现图书管理系统,文中示例代码介绍的非常详细,具有一定的参考价值,感兴趣的小伙伴们可以参考一下本文实例为大家分享了mybatis实现图书管理系统的具体代码,供大家参考,具体内容如下 在项目开始前先将数据库中的关系表建立,先分析需要几个模块表,用户,图书,类别,租借,购买,简单的https://www.jb51.net/article/188907.htm
9.图书管理系统总体设计3.4系统配置 图3-6图书管理系统系统配置图 图3-6为图书管理系统的配置图,图书管理系统的应用服务负责保存整个管理系统的应用程序,数据库是负责数据的管理,此外还有多个终端,对于不同的用户,有不同的客户端。 3.5数据库设计 3.5.1数据库逻辑设计(ER模型) (a)书籍实体 (b) 用户个人信息实体 (c)管理员个人信息实https://www.jianshu.com/p/7967c63b2f75
10.基于SSM的图书馆管理系统关注公众号:程序员王不二,回复关键词 :图书馆,获取完整版源码 http://weixin.qq.com/r/DBP370PEph7ZrQeM90Ye (二维码自动识别) 1、项目介绍 基于SSM的图书馆管理系统分为两个角色: 管理员:新增、编辑图书,确认归还图书、所有借阅记录查询 用户:借阅图书、查看往过的借阅记录、查看当前自己借阅的图书 https://zhuanlan.zhihu.com/p/539717006
11.试题三某单位资料室需要建立一个图书管理系统,初步的需求分析结果根据以上说明设计的实体联系图如下图所示,请指出读者与图书、书目与读者、书目与图书之间的联系类型。 [问题2] 该图书管理系统的主要关系模式如下,请补充“借还记录”和“预约登记”关系中的空缺。 管理员(工号,姓名) 读者(读者ID,姓名,电话,E-mail) https://www.cnitpm.com/st/245388453.html
12.数据库课程设计报告图书管理系统20240511195948.docx近年来,随着我国市场经济的迅速发展和人们生活水平的不断提高,以及计算机的普及使用,图书馆藏书的数目逐渐增大,这也是挑战了图书管理方面的技术,以前的人工管理方式已经不再适应现在的环境,取而代之的是先进的图书管理系统,提高了图书馆的工作效率,为想要借书和还书的人提供更好的服务。 https://max.book118.com/html/2024/0511/7113011161006105.shtm
13.创业经营策划书精选5篇心语中文网前期通过与高校文学社团的合作,为文学社团在心语建立自己的社团主页,形成一个全国性的独特浩大的社团联盟。在此同时,心语将与与各类实体虚体社团展开合作,互相宣传推广,以期达到资源互通,人才共享。 心语中文网将一直为优秀文学爱好者提供网络文学发表的平台,发掘优质网络作者,并进行经典作品的收集管理。逐步创https://www.liuxue86.com/a/4785803.html
14.结构化查询语言SQL习题与答案3) 在已经形成的关系模型下,举例说明连接运算、投影运算、选择运算。 参考答案:(属性写在了实体和联系图形内) 任务: 1) 根据需求描述,分别为“图书管理系统”的不同功能模块绘制局部E-R图。 教师信息管理: 图书基本信息管理: 借还书登记: 催还书登记: https://www.oh100.com/peixun/SQL/426451.html
15.政府信息公开着力加强区、街道、社区三级公共管理服务平台,实现网络相连、信息互通、资源联享,加大智慧社区建设投入,统筹解决顶层设计、平台建设、人员培训管理服务及资金保障等方面的问题,实现一网通办和一网统管,全面提升基层治理的能力和水平。推进云计算、大数据、物联网、人工智能等产业发展,强化应用端建设,推动区块链技术与实体http://www.huangzhou.gov.cn/zwgk/public/6635142/1436124.html
16.档案管理考题1.档案与图书、资料的本质区别在于( ) A.服务性 B.利用性 C.原始性 D.参考性 2.建立档案实体秩序,使档案系统化的工作为( ) A.整理工作 B.收集工作 C.利用工作 D.检索工作 3.维护档案的完整,从质量上要( ) A.保证齐全 B.保持有机联系 C.力求不受损坏 D.尽量延长寿命 4.党和国家指导和管理档案工https://www.danganj.com/news/20308.html
17.推荐信息中心工作计划四篇3.明确职责,提高图书室及阅览室工作责任心和工作质量。 4.做好图书上机编目上架。 5.做好图书日常工作,图书编目、期刊登记,新旧书编目,整理清洁卫生工作等,要以良好的心态,还要积极的服务认真的态度做好图书上机编目的一切工作。 6.图书室图书管理系统需更换,做的图书信息化管理。 https://www.unjs.com/fanwenwang/gzjh/20221030171517_5834112.html
18.泸州市第一次“哲学社会科学优秀科研成果”获奖项目4、《“二化”教学系统引论》(论文) 《四川师范大学学报》1988年2期 郭让荣(泸州市一中) 5、《高校校报的归属、编制及其他》(论文) 《校报研究》1989年1期 杨绍浦(泸州医学院) 6、《也谈建设企业文化》(论文) 《当代管理研究》1989年2期 周宏(泸州市计经委) http://www.lzskl.com/jsp/detail_content/1327